How Can You Find the Right Mineral Sunscreen for Dry Skin?

A mineral sunscreen is formulated with zinc oxide and titanium dioxide to protect the skin from UV damage. These sunscreens are not harsh on sensitive or dry skin. Still, not all mineral sunscreens will work well on dry skin because some may be too heavy or mattifying.
